Starting Strong: The Itinerary Breakdown

Private - Skip the Line- Ancient Athens Tour (Including Acropolis) - Starting Strong: The Itinerary Breakdown

This four-hour tour is designed to hit the highlights while allowing for some personal discovery. The experience kicks off with a visit to the National Archaeological Museum, Greece’s largest and one of the world’s premier museums. With an hour to explore, you’ll see everything from ancient sculptures to artifacts that tell stories of Greek civilization. The guide, Merkouris, is praised for his personable approach and wealth of knowledge, making this part of the tour both educational and engaging.

Next, the group heads to the Panathenaic Stadium, where the first modern Olympic Games were held in 1896. This 30-minute stop is a quick but memorable photo opportunity, especially since it’s free to enter. Here, you can marvel at the marble construction and imagine the athletic competitions that once took place there. The guide’s commentary helps bring the history alive, making it more than just a sightseeing photo op.

The highlight, of course, is the Acropolis. You’re given two hours to explore this ancient citadel, home to some of the most famous monuments in the world, including the Parthenon. The included entrance ticket means no waiting in lines—just a chance to wander the ruins at your own pace. You’ll love the flexibility to linger or explore specific areas more deeply, guided by your expert. Reviewers mention how the guide shared intriguing “secrets of the Acropolis,” adding layers of understanding to the stunning views and structures.
